Transaction 077158782c80c3c36f99fe12b2ffdd36c961d42c087b9e5226296ed908deac72
2 Input
2 Outputs
- 077158782c80c3c36f99fe12b2ffdd36c961d42c087b9e5226296ed908deac72:0
- 077158782c80c3c36f99fe12b2ffdd36c961d42c087b9e5226296ed908deac72:1
value 69486
address 1AN8euf1zU4Am6wwQD9DPDvjYP1GYfBJYa
value 5183581
address 3Ck1dKmVfKw76xGZUfg244aAc3UJ6ftRMT